Overview
Classic Electric Piano Sounds at Your Fingertips
Digidesign Velvet is a virtual instrument plugin that faithfully recreates the sound of classic Fender Rhodes and Wurlitzer electric pianos. Using dynamic modeling technology, Velvet delivers realistic and expressive tones that will inspire your music productions.
Specifications:
- Plugin Type: RTAS
- Compatibility: Pro Tools
- Instruments Emulated: Fender Rhodes, Wurlitzer electric pianos
- Technology: Dynamic Modeling
